In this episode of The Drafting Table, Alex Rosemblat (Advisor and Former CMO at Datadog) joins us for a tactical breakdown of how startups should actually think about marketing — especially in the early days.
We cover:
- Why “knowing your customer” is a cliché…until you realize you really don’t
- How Datadog thought about scoping, focus, and qualifying customers out
- What kinds of marketing campaigns actually worked — and which failed
- A simple formula any founder can use to figure out how much pipeline they actually need
- The biggest mistake technical founders make when trying to build go-to-market
- How Datadog transitioned from PLG to enterprise — and the hidden lessons they learned
